Abstract:
Described herein are systems, methods and computer program products for controlling operation of wireless network devices, such as wireless access points and wireless client devices. The techniques described simplify the process of associating wireless devices with wireless networks. Wireless devices can associate with a wireless access point without knowing details of the wireless access point, such as a service set identifier (SSID). Upon associating with a wireless access point, client devices cease transmission of or reduce a transmission rate of wireless probe requests, resulting in more efficient wireless radio frequency use and reduced possibility of interference due to wireless probe request transmissions.
